You may choose to engage in arbitration hearings by telephone. Arbitration hearings not conducted by
telephone shall take place in a location reasonably accessible from your primary residence, or in Orange
County, California, at your option.
a) Initiation of Arbitration Proceeding. If either you or Epson decides to arbitrate a Dispute, both parties
agree to the following procedure:
(i) Write a Demand for Arbitration. The demand must include a description of the Dispute and the amount
of damages sought to be recovered. You can find a copy of a Demand for Arbitration at
http://www.jamsadr.com ("Demand for Arbitration").
(ii) Send three copies of the Demand for Arbitration, plus the appropriate filing fee, to: JAMS, 500 North
State College Blvd., Suite 600 Orange, CA 92868, U.S.A.
(iii) Send one copy of the Demand for Arbitration to the other party (same address as the Dispute
Notice), or as otherwise agreed by the parties.
b) Hearing Format. During the arbitration, the amount of any settlement offer made shall not be disclosed
to the arbitrator until after the arbitrator determines the amount, if any, to which you or Epson is entitled.
The discovery or exchange of non-privileged information relevant to the Dispute may be allowed during
the arbitration.
c) Arbitration Fees. Epson shall pay, or (if applicable) reimburse you for, all JAMS filings and arbitrator
fees for any arbitration commenced (by you or Epson) pursuant to provisions of this Agreement.
d) Award in Your Favor. For Disputes in which you or Epson seeks $75,000 or less in damages exclusive
of attorney's fees and costs, if the arbitrator's decision results in an award to you in an amount greater
than Epson's last written offer, if any, to settle the Dispute, Epson will: (i) pay you $1,000 or the amount
of the award, whichever is greater; (ii) pay you twice the amount of your reasonable attorney's fees, if
any; and (iii) reimburse you for any expenses (including expert witness fees and costs) that your attorney
reasonably accrues for investigating, preparing, and pursuing the Dispute in arbitration. Except as
agreed upon by you and Epson in writing, the arbitrator shall determine the amount of fees, costs, and
expenses to be paid by Epson pursuant to this Section 1.6d).

Epson DS-1630 Specifications

General IconGeneral
DisplayLCD
Scanner typeFlatbed scanner
Product colorBlack, White
Built-in displayNo
Film scanning-
Color scanningYes
Maximum scan size210 x 3048 mm
ADF scan speed (b/w, A4)25 ppm
Enhanced scan resolution1200 x 1200 DPI
Optical scanning resolution600 x 600 DPI
Maximum scan area (ADF)89 x 127 mm
ISO A-series sizes (A0...A9)A4, A5, A6
ISO B-series sizes (B0...B9)B5
Maximum ISO A-series paper sizeA4
Auto Document Feeder (ADF) media weight50 - 120 g/m²
Scan driversISIS, TWAIN
Scan file formatsPDF, TIFF
Scanning noise level55 dB
Daily duty cycle (max)1500 pages
Auto document feeder (ADF) input capacity50 sheets
USB version3.2 Gen 1 (3.1 Gen 1)
Standard interfacesUSB 3.2 Gen 1 (3.1 Gen 1)
Sustainability certificatesENERGY STAR
Storage temperature (T-T)-20 - 60 °C
Operating temperature (T-T)10 - 35 °C
Operating relative humidity (H-H)20 - 80 %
Cables includedAC, USB
Power supply typeAC
Supported network protocolsTCP/IP, DHCP, DNS, SNMP, SLP
Harmonized System (HS) code84716070
Weight and Dimensions IconWeight and Dimensions
Depth315 mm
Width451 mm
Height120 mm
Weight3700 g
